Mar 25 2025On Thursday 20th March three children completed the first of three Build-a-Bike sessions.
They had an amazing day, used active listening skills, really taking on board what the instructors Steve and Paul were showing and telling them. The children learnt how to build a bicycle from scratch. The children started with just their frame. After unwrapping and attaching the frame to the stand they added the wheels.
The children added their brakes: front and back, the gears and the pedals, the last part to add was the chain and checking it was on tight enough to work well with the gear changes.
All three children worked so well and used an assortment of tools correctly and were so proud of the hard work they achieved. Children even enjoyed a chance to ride their bicycles once they were finished.
Children were allows to take the bicycles home, they were provided helmets, bicycle locks and lights. Also children were successful in securing four AQA unit awards – watch this space for certificates.
